> This might be a duplicate of 535650 but I don't think so: it should be
> fixed in 1.49. The error seems to come from this call to ethtool:
>
> mar...@haktar:~$ sudo ethtool -s eth0 speed 0
> ethtool: bad command line argument(s)
> For more information run ethtool -h
>
> This bug might be related to ethtool, but such errors should be handeled
> more graciously...
>


Thanks for reporting it. The error appears for NIC drivers which don't respond 
to mii-tool. And yes, the error should be handled.
